What is a 6900ZZ Bearing?


A 6900ZZ bearing is a type of deep groove ball bearing, characterized by its compact design and ability to accommodate radial and axial loads in both directions. The '69' series refers to its designation within a standard numbering system used by manufacturers, while '00' denotes its specific dimensions, which typically feature an outer diameter of 22 mm, an inner diameter of 10 mm, and a width of 6 mm.


The 'ZZ' suffix indicates that the bearing is shielded on both sides, providing protection against dirt, dust, and other contaminants. This feature is crucial for maintaining the longevity and reliability of the bearing in various environments.


Key Features of 6900ZZ Bearings


1. Compact Size The relatively small dimensions make the 6900ZZ bearing ideal for applications where space is limited. Its design allows for a high load-carrying capacity, despite its size.


2. Sealed for Protection The dual shields provide an effective barrier against contamination, ensuring smooth operation and reducing maintenance requirements. This is particularly important in applications exposed to harsh conditions.


3. Low Friction The deep groove design facilitates low-friction operation, translating to increased efficiency and reduced energy consumption. This characteristic is essential in applications that require quiet operation and minimal wear.


4. Versatile Load Handling The 6900ZZ bearing can support both radial and axial loads, making it suitable for a variety of applications, from electric motors to automotive components.


5. Durability and Longevity Constructed with high-quality materials, typically chrome steel or stainless steel, these bearings are designed to withstand substantial operational stresses, leading to prolonged service life.

Applications of 6900ZZ Bearings


Due to its robust design and dynamic capabilities, the 6900ZZ bearing finds a wide range of applications across multiple industries. Some of the most common applications include


1. Electric Motors The 6900ZZ bearing’s low friction and high load capacity make it a popular choice for electric motors, where efficient energy transfer is crucial.


2. Robotics In robotics, precision and reliability are paramount. The 6900ZZ bearing plays a vital role in ensuring smooth movements in robotic arms and joints.


3. Bicycles and E-Bikes These bearings are often used in bicycle hubs, where they support the rotational movement of the wheel while providing durability and resistance to environmental factors.


4. Industrial Machinery In various industrial machines, from conveyor systems to packaging equipment, the 6900ZZ bearing ensures efficient operation and minimizes downtime due to wear and tear.


5. Automotive Components The bearing is utilized in various automotive applications, including in the steering column and transmission systems, where it helps ensure smooth interactions between moving parts.
